1A Motor Drive IC for Motor Applications
MB3853
s DESCRIPTION
The FUJITSU MB3853 is a motor drive IC with two power driver channels capable of sink/source operation, for use in two-channel independent operation or H-type drive operation. The control system and output system have independent power supplies, allowing the control system to be set to low-voltage operation to conserve power. Protective circuits are provided for temperature, overvoltage, and overload current, with an open collector type monitoring terminal. The MB3853 is designed for use with motors in AV products, office automation products, or cameras, and is also an ideal IC for use in automated vending equipment and other unmanned operating devices.

s FUNCTIONAL DESCRIPTION
The MB3853 provides two methods for controlling motors. The IC can be connected to two motors and drive each motor independently, or connected to one motor in an H-type connection and drive the motor in forward and reverse directions.

s PROTECTIVE CIRCUITS
Circuit name Operating description Timing chart
Detection level
Overvol tage protection circuit
When the Vcc2 supply voltage input exceeds 33 V (Typ.) , the following occurs : (1) All output transistors are turned off, and output is set to high impedance (2) As long as the condition is detected, the monitoring output from the open collector terminal is set to "L" level.

Temperature protection circuit
When the chip temperature exceeds TJ = +180 C, the following occurs : (1) All output transistors are turned off, and output is set to high impedance (2) As long as the condition is detected, the monitoring output from the open collector terminal is set to "L" level.
